@import "https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700;800&family=Nanum+Myeongjo:wght@400;700;800&display=swap";
:root{--color-primary:#5b272f;--color-primary-dark:#3a181e;--color-primary-light:#7a3a44;--color-background:#fdf5ea;--color-background-alt:#f7ede0;--color-text-main:#33151b;--color-text-muted:#7d5951;--color-logo-burgundy:#5b272f;--color-logo-gold:#c19c72;--color-accent-gold:var(--color-logo-gold);--color-cream:#fdf5ea;--color-cream-dark:#f0e4d4;--transition-fast:.2s cubic-bezier(.4, 0, .2, 1);--transition-normal:.4s cubic-bezier(.4, 0, .2, 1);--shadow-sm:0 2px 8px #5b272f0f;--shadow-md:0 8px 24px #5b272f1a;--shadow-lg:0 16px 48px #5b272f24;--shadow-xl:0 24px 64px #5b272f2e;--radius-sm:8px;--radius-md:12px;--radius-lg:20px;--radius-xl:28px}html{scroll-behavior:smooth}html,body{box-sizing:border-box;background-color:var(--color-background);color:var(--color-text-main);-webkit-font-smoothing:antialiased;word-break:keep-all;overflow-wrap:break-word;margin:0;padding:0;font-family:Inter,-apple-system,BlinkMacSystemFont,sans-serif;overflow-x:hidden}*,:before,:after{box-sizing:inherit;word-break:keep-all;overflow-wrap:break-word}a{color:inherit;text-decoration:none}h1,h2,h3,h4,h5,h6{color:var(--color-primary);margin:0;font-weight:700}@keyframes fadeInUp{0%{opacity:0;transform:translateY(40px)}to{opacity:1;transform:translateY(0)}}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-8px)}}@keyframes fadeSlideIn{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}@keyframes pulse-glow{0%,to{box-shadow:0 0 #c19c724d}50%{box-shadow:0 0 20px 8px #c19c7226}}::-webkit-scrollbar{width:8px}::-webkit-scrollbar-track{background:var(--color-cream)}::-webkit-scrollbar-thumb{background:var(--color-logo-gold);border-radius:4px}::-webkit-scrollbar-thumb:hover{background:var(--color-primary)}::selection{color:var(--color-primary);background-color:#c19c724d}@keyframes slideDown{0%{opacity:0;top:-100px}to{opacity:1;top:20px}}@keyframes marqueeScroll{0%{transform:translate(0)}to{transform:translate(-50%)}}.premium-nav{z-index:9990;-webkit-backdrop-filter:blur(20px);background:#fdf5ead9;border-bottom:1px solid #c19c7233;justify-content:space-around;align-items:center;padding:10px 30px;transition:all .3s;display:flex;position:fixed;top:0;left:0;right:0;box-shadow:0 4px 30px #5b272f14}.premium-nav-btn{cursor:pointer;background:0 0;border:none;border-radius:14px;flex-direction:column;align-items:center;gap:4px;padding:6px 16px;text-decoration:none;transition:all .25s;display:flex}.premium-nav-btn:hover{background:#c19c7226;transform:translateY(-2px)}.premium-nav-btn:active{transform:scale(.92)}.premium-nav-icon-wrap{background:linear-gradient(135deg,#ffffffe6,#f0e4d499);border-radius:12px;justify-content:center;align-items:center;width:40px;height:40px;transition:all .25s;display:flex;box-shadow:0 3px 12px #5b272f1a,inset 0 1px 2px #fffc}.premium-nav-btn:hover .premium-nav-icon-wrap{transform:scale(1.08);box-shadow:0 6px 20px #5b272f26,inset 0 1px 2px #ffffffe6}.premium-nav-icon-wrap.church{background:linear-gradient(135deg,#5b272f14,#c19c7226);border:1.5px solid #c19c724d;width:46px;height:46px}.premium-nav-label{color:var(--color-text-muted);letter-spacing:-.02em;font-size:.72rem;font-weight:700;transition:color .2s}.premium-nav-btn:hover .premium-nav-label{color:var(--color-primary)}.church-label{font-weight:800;color:var(--color-primary)!important}body.has-topnav{padding-top:80px!important}@media (max-width:768px){.premium-nav{padding:8px 20px;padding-bottom:calc(8px + env(safe-area-inset-bottom));background:#fdf5eaf2;border-top:1px solid #c19c7240;border-bottom:none;top:auto;bottom:0;box-shadow:0 -4px 30px #5b272f1a}body.has-topnav{padding-top:0!important;padding-bottom:90px!important}.premium-nav-icon-wrap{border-radius:14px;width:44px;height:44px}.premium-nav-icon-wrap.church{width:50px;height:50px}.premium-nav-label{font-size:.7rem}}
